School of Parma; XVII century.
"Madonna".
Oil on canvas. Relined.
Measurements: 86 x 72 cm.
The work represents the Virgin in a half bust format with her head gently bent and her gaze lowered in an attitude of recollection. The face of delicate features is modeled by means of very soft tonal transitions without marked edges which confers to the figure a soft and almost ethereal presence The treatment of the flesh is warm and luminous and reveals a special interest for the sfumato and for the chromatic gradation subordinating the drawing to the color and to the light The palette dominated by ochers and golds, which gives the figure a soft and almost ethereal presence The palette dominated by ochers and golds, which gives the figure a soft and almost ethereal presence The palette is dominated by ochers and golds. palette dominated by deep green golden ochres and reddish touches contributes to create an enveloping and serene atmosphere far from the most intense baroque dramatism, while the neutral dark background without spatial references reinforces the introspective character of the image and concentrates the attention on the meditative expression of the face.
From the stylistic point of view, the painting is fully in the tradition of the School of Parma, direct heir of the language of Correggio, whose influence continued throughout the 17th century This heritage is manifested in the search for an idealized beauty in the extreme softness of the modeling, in the taste for enveloping forms and in a spirituality expressed through inner emotion rather than theatrical gesture In contrast to Caravaggio's naturalism and the strongly dramatic Roman Baroque, the Parmesan school maintained a lyrical sensibility based on the predominance of color over drawing, on the delicacy of light transitions and on an affective religiosity destined for private contemplation.
